City of New York SQL Developer/DBA Senior in New York, New York
Job Description
Must be permanent in the Computer Specialist (Software) Title or reachable of the current civil service list. Employees who are permanent in the Certified IT Developer Applications civil service title may also apply for this position.
We are seeking a highly experienced Senior SQL Developer/DBA.
Under supervision, with latitude for independent action and the exercise of independent judgment, are responsible for performing highly technical and supervisory responsibilities in applications development, including planning, designing, configuring, installing, testing, troubleshooting, integrating, performance monitoring, maintaining, enhancing, security management, and support of complex computer applications programs. This role is critical for ensuring our mission-critical databases' optimal performance, reliability, and security.
The Computer Specialist level 4, may supervise a small unit engaged in the above duties; may serve as a project leader of projects involving computer applications programs, independently perform development, testing or maintenance work of highly technical nature. In the temporary absence of the supervisor, the individual may perform the duties of that position. Please provide all IT Certification(s) related to this work requirement.
Perform tasks to design, develop, implement, and maintain SQL Server database entities to ensure all development/ modification of database schema, code are following best practice standards, security controls, automation, when possible, in accordance with projects’ requirements.
Hands-on experiences and abilities to develop, modify complex systems: databases scheme and code release processes, data query building, SSIS packages, SSRS, data maintenance, etc
Create and maintain database queries, stored procedures, SQL Jobs, SSIS packages, especially complex SSIS interface with multiple data sources.
Work with the Development and Design team and users to ensure successful development of business, functional, and technical specifications.
Troubleshooting SQL databases, queries to ensure they are performing optimally which includes design choices during development.
Create, manage and modify database SSRS reporting services and data mining, including business analysis leverage MS power (BI) tools. Support SSRA Ad hoc reports from other divisions request on-demand.
Proactively monitor SQL Server maintenance tasks, troubleshoot failed processes & troubleshooting critical scheduled tasks & processes (SQLAgent jobs, Etc.)
Maintain high availability and scalability: Configure and manage high-availability solutions such as AlwaysOn: availability groups and failover clustering; well-versed with replication methodology, and failover in MS-SQL Database
Ensure security control: enforce comprehensive security policies and standard for database access, encryption, and auditing; perform Security patches and upgrades
Implement data models and database designs, table maintenance and data access at REST and encryption to ensure data integrity is intact.
Update and maintain backup and recovery: Manage database backup and recovery and disaster recovery planning
Documentation and Reporting: Create and maintain detailed documentation of database architectures, configurations, processes and solutions. Provide regular reports on database performance and status.
COMPUTER SPECIALIST (SOFTWARE) - 13632
Qualifications
(1) A baccalaureate degree from an accredited college, including or supplemented by twenty-four (24) semester credits in computer science or a related computer field and two (2) years of satisfactory full-time software experience in designing, programming, debugging, maintaining, implementing, and enhancing computer software applications, systems programming, systems analysis and design, data communication software, or database design and programming, including one year in a project leader capacity or as a major contributor on a complex project; or
(2) A four-year high school diploma or its educational equivalent and six (6) years of full-time satisfactory software experience as described in “1" above, including one year in a project leader capacity or as a major contributor on a complex project; or
(3) A satisfactory combination of education and experience that is equivalent to (1) or (2) above. College education may be substituted for up to two years of the required experience in (2) above on the basis that sixty (60) semester credits from an accredited college is equated to one year of experience. A masters degree in computer science or a related computer field may be substituted for one year of the required experience in (1) or (2) above. However, all candidates must have a four year high school diploma or its educational equivalent, plus at least one (1) year of satisfactory full-time software experience in a project leader capacity or as a major contributor on a complex project.
NOTE: In order to have your experience accepted as Project Leader or Major Contributor experience, you must explain in detail how your experience qualifies you as a project leader or as a major contributor. Experience in computer operations, technical support, quality assurance (QA), hardware installation, help desk, or as an end user will not be accepted for meeting the minimum qualification
requirements.
Special Note
To be eligible for placement in Assignment Level IV, in addition to the Qualification Requirements stated above, individuals must have one year of satisfactory experience in a project leader capacity or as a major contributor on a complex project in data administration, database management systems, operating systems, data communications systems, capacity planning, and/or on-line applications programming.
